Thanks to the publication of a study by the NRO (Number Resource Organization) that is the official representative of the five RIRs (Regional Internet Registries) that oversee the allocation of all Internet number resources, we learned the following:

  • Over 50% of respondents note that the cost of deployment of IPv6 is a major barrier to adoption and deployment.
  • Over 45% of respondents report inabilities to find IPv6 knowledgeable technical staff to support deployment.

The survey polled over 1,500 organizations from 140 countries.

Here are some other interesting facts:

  • 70% already offer or plan to offer IPv6 to businesses within the next year
  • 60% already offer or plan to offer IPv6 to consumers within the next year
  • 10% have no plans to offer IPv6
